What are enzymatic digesters, and how do they work in Japan?

Enzymatic digesters are bioconversion systems that use enzymes to accelerate organic waste breakdown, producing biogas and digestate. In Japan, they are increasingly adopted for sustainable waste management, converting food and agricultural waste into renewable energy efficiently.

What are the environmental benefits of enzymatic digestion in Japan?

It reduces landfill reliance, lowers greenhouse gas emissions, recovers renewable energy, and produces nutrient-rich digestate for agriculture, aligning with Japan’s climate commitments.
